The book "Recent Heat Engines" offers a comprehensive analysis and detailed description of various heat engines, including steam engines, steam turbines, and gas engines. It is aimed at professionals and enthusiasts in the fields of mathematics and natural sciences, highlighting current developments in heat engine technology. With 87 illustrations and a plate, the topic is presented in a clear and understandable manner. The content is summarized over 115 pages, providing both theoretical and practical insights into the operation and applications of these machines.
